Output 58938ff83e94f633ed596a89aa89a8b338d47f2fe344f2e393af35b424831f52:0
- value
- 24554000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 591f6aa651c29b7b0215396bbd9a039f0540c140 OP_EQUALVERIFY OP_CHECKSIG
- address
- DDGLKCGFgeM7HefQ5N3PxdKBLJJjkWtFUR
- transaction
- 58938ff83e94f633ed596a89aa89a8b338d47f2fe344f2e393af35b424831f52